The Raging Grannies started in the States (where else ; )
It;s largely made up here of folks from the Women for Peace movement but anyone can join. Basically it's 'Granny' aged women who are sick of the governments (or who ever) not listening to the people and to common sense!
We have a song to the good old "Glory Allelujah" song
Were the Raging Grannies and were here to take a stand
against the senseless killing raging in Afghanistan
Sudan, the Middle East and in Iraq and every land
We RAGE to END ALL WAR!!!
We are sick of being lied to, sick and tired of being lied to,
By silent politicians who rage wars that kill our sons
We rage to end All war ; )

We generally write our own songs in Dutch to 'known melodies' and take the texts with us on a flipover so everyone who wants to can join in.

We don't just rage against war but environment and social injustice etc.

We are a grand bunch of ladies. When we are working on a text it sounds more like a chikcen coop!!!

Our next event will be on Womens Day ; ) In December we went and sang in Parliament (which isn't allowed, but we stood up and sang a relevant text as we left the room ; ) So we were not removed (as they put in the papers ; () The debat was about whether we should extend "our time" in afghanistan we said they should withdraw the army/ forces and use the money for NGO's .... ok of course they didn't listen, but we got a lot of airtime ... with interviews on radio.
